At 70, Herald prints the last words: Farewell

Farewell. T V Venkitachalam's leave-taking from National Herald as its editor-in-chief was such a scene that only a dying newspaper could offer. Behind the door with a faded bronze nameplate that announced his designation, Venkitachalam sat in his chamber with volumes of Encyclopedia Britannica, a huge portrait of a brooding Pandit Nehru, a telephone that occasionally rings, and an old typewriter going off colour.
